Water is the backdrop of life in Bellaire, the county seat. Swimming, boating, fishing and beach-combing are summer activities that give way in the fall to driving tours along some of Michigan's most scenic back roads. In the winter, snowmobile trails, sledding spots and Shanty Creek's ski slopes provide plenty of fun. Golf swings into action in the spring as the area heats up again. The Village's 1,200 residents also know how to throw a party. Each August the town has a fabulous festival downtown with food, arts, crafts, a parade and a rubber-ducky race. Other annual activities include the Classic Car Show in July and September's Harvest Festival & Scarecrow Extravaganza.
